How to Identify Monkeypox Symptoms in the Early Stages

Monkeypox is a rare and serious viral disease that can cause fever, rash, and other symptoms. If left untreated, it can lead to severe complications and even death. Identifying monkeypox symptoms in the early stages is crucial to getting prompt medical attention and preventing the spread of the disease. In this article, we will discuss 10 key symptoms to look out for in the early stages of monkeypox.

1. Fever

One of the earliest symptoms of monkeypox is a fever. The fever can start suddenly and may be accompanied by chills, body aches, and fatigue. If you have a fever that lasts more than a few days, it is important to seek medical attention.

2. Headache

Another common early symptom of monkeypox is a headache. The headache may be mild or severe and can last for several days. If you experience a persistent headache along with other symptoms, you should see a doctor.

3. Muscle aches

Muscle aches are another early symptom of monkeypox. The aches can be mild or severe and can affect various parts of the body. If you have muscle aches that are accompanied by other symptoms, it is important to seek medical attention.

4. Fatigue

Fatigue is a common symptom of many illnesses, including monkeypox. The fatigue can be mild or severe and can last for several days. If you feel unusually tired and have other symptoms, you should see a doctor.

5. Swollen lymph nodes

Swollen lymph nodes are a common symptom of monkeypox. The lymph nodes may be tender and painful to the touch. If you have swollen lymph nodes along with other symptoms, you should see a doctor.

6. Rash

One of the hallmark symptoms of monkeypox is a rash. The rash can appear anywhere on the body and may be accompanied by itching. If you develop a rash, it is important to see a doctor.

7. Lesions

Monkeypox can cause lesions on the skin. The lesions may be small and fluid-filled or larger and more painful. If you have lesions along with other symptoms, you should see a doctor.

8. Sore throat

A sore throat is a common symptom of many illnesses, including monkeypox. The sore throat may be mild or severe and can last for several days. If you have a sore throat along with other symptoms, you should see a doctor.

9. Cough

A cough is another common symptom of many illnesses, including monkeypox. The cough may be dry or productive and can last for several days. If you have a cough along with other symptoms, you should see a doctor.

10. Shortness of breath

In severe cases of monkeypox, shortness of breath may occur. If you have trouble breathing or feel short of breath, you should seek medical attention immediately.

In conclusion, monkeypox is a serious viral disease that can cause a variety of symptoms. If you experience any of the symptoms listed above, it is important to seek medical attention right away. Early identification and treatment of monkeypox can help prevent complications and ensure a speedy recovery.
